In a quiet sanctuary bathed in the golden hues of early morning, an extraordinary tapestry stretches across the northern wall—a living display crafted not from thread or glass, but from the glowing calligraphy of sacred scripture. At the foundation, carved deeply into polished olive wood, rest the majestic words of Psalm 19:1: The heavens declare the glory of God; and the firmament sheweth his handywork. Above this wooden base, luminous silver ink branches upward like soaring wings, carrying the enduring encouragement of Isaiah 40:31: They that wait upon the Lord shall renew their strength; they shall mount up with wings as eagles; they shall run, and not be weary; and they shall walk, and not faint.
As sunlight pierces through the tall arched windows, the center of the artwork catches fire with deep crimson lettering, setting down a bedrock of spiritual direction from Proverbs 3:5-6: Trust in the Lord with all thine heart; and lean not unto thine own understanding. In all thy ways acknowledge him, and he shall direct thy paths. The visual narrative draws the viewer upward toward a towering lantern sculpted at the display's summit, where silver leaf captures the radiant call of Matthew 5:14, 16: Ye are the light of the world. A city that is set on an hill cannot be hid...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works, and glorify your Father which is in heaven.
This grand display serves as more than a physical monument; it stands as a visual dedication to Jehovah’s Saints—the faithful, set-apart followers who carry these holy declarations within their hearts. These believers do not merely admire the word; they reflect it. Their lives form a living extension of the sanctuary wall, channeling divine wisdom into everyday action. Inspired by the truths carved before them, their life's purpose expands into active ministry. Through teaching, selfless service, and compassionate outreach, their ministry carries the brilliant light of the scriptures beyond the sanctuary doors, offering hope, direction, and peace to the world.
